Southern Oregon artist Deb Van Poolen wanted a website to promote her art classes, showcase her natural landscape and wildlife art for sale, and house her political articles. Ruby Slipper embraced the project!

CHALLENGE
Artist Deb Van Poolen teaches drawing and painting, offers art and ecology classes at her Greensprings studio, sells posters and prints online, at the Lithia Artisans Market, and the Ashland Art Center. She’s also known for her political insights from her experience as a courtroom artist and world traveler.
Our challenge: getting super clear on Deb’s focus areas and how to visually portray her site.
APPROACH
To gain inspiration and clarity, we explored all sorts of artist websites, During the design phase, the pendulum swung from white/austere to the lush, full-bodied design presented now. Deb’s artistic eye was invaluable as we crafted a look-and-feel that best represented her work.
RESULTS
Her new site, Biodiversity Arts, showcases all that she offers in a big, bold way.
